About LADDER TYPE CABLE TRAY

A cable tray is a structural system used to securely support and organize electrical cables, wires, and communication lines in industrial, commercial, and residential settings. It provides a safe pathway for wiring, helping to maintain organization and ease of maintenance while ensuring compliance with electrical codes. Cable trays are especially useful in environments where frequent changes to wiring systems are expected, such as data centers, factories, and large office buildings.

Constructed from materials like galvanized steel, stainless steel, aluminum, or fiberglass-reinforced plastic, cable trays offer strength, durability, and resistance to corrosion. They come in various types, including ladder, perforated, solid bottom, and wire mesh trays, each suited to specific installation needs. For example, ladder trays allow maximum ventilation and are ideal for heavy-duty cables, while solid-bottom trays offer better protection in dusty or moist environments.

Cable trays are typically mounted on walls, ceilings, or under raised floors and are available in different sizes and shapes to accommodate various cable capacities. Their modular design allows easy expansion or reconfiguration of cable systems. By promoting better cable management, reducing fire risks, and simplifying troubleshooting, cable trays play a critical role in efficient and safe electrical system design.
